你查询的IP:[222.64.47.214]  地理位置:中国–上海–上海–普陀区

最新查询118.64.203.39 60.232.107.70 59.64.155.241 118.84.29.175 61.236.67.147 121.58.214.15 203.212.117.94 219.82.48.109 58.32.221.106 222.64.47.214 210.15.128.107 221.8.93.153 203.18.50.167 121.204.185.231 202.164.25.182 202.74.8.85 61.4.80.136 210.5.175.220 123.244.141.235 117.40.7.212 221.172.141.118 202.74.8.201 117.121.178.57 123.244.236.82 122.4.33.131 125.62.70.213 202.38.64.91 202.131.208.164 124.88.89.180 121.68.212.224 220.234.241.170